Types of Auto Insurance Coverage

Liability Coverage

Liability coverage is mandatory in Virginia. It covers damages and injuries to others if you're at fault in an accident. For more information about liability coverage, you can visit liability car insurance texas.

Collision and Comprehensive Coverage

While not required by law, these coverages protect your vehicle in the event of an accident or non-collision incidents like theft or natural disasters.

  • Collision: Pays for damages to your car resulting from a collision.
  • Comprehensive: Covers non-collision related damages.

Factors Affecting Insurance Rates

Several factors can influence your auto insurance premiums:

  1. Driving Record: A clean record can lower your rates.
  2. Vehicle Type: Luxury and sports cars typically have higher premiums.
  3. Location: Urban areas may have higher rates due to increased risk of accidents.
  4. Credit Score: Insurers may use credit scores to assess risk.

FAQ

What is the minimum insurance requirement in Staunton, VA?

Virginia law requires minimum liability coverage of 25/50/20, meaning $25,000 for bodily injury per person, $50,000 for total bodily injury per accident, and $20,000 for property damage.

How can I lower my auto insurance premiums?

Maintaining a good driving record, opting for a higher deductible, and taking advantage of discounts for safe driving courses can help reduce premiums.

Does Virginia offer uninsured motorist coverage?

Yes, uninsured motorist coverage is required in Virginia, providing protection if you're involved in an accident with an uninsured driver.
